Google has announced a $1.5 billion investment spanning 2026 and 2027 to expand its data center campus in Jackson County, Alabama. The expansion will scale regional computing capacity while requiring Google to self-fund 100% of its power and infrastructure costs. This major capital commitment highlights how tech leaders are pouring resources into regional infrastructure to power expanding digital services.
Infrastructure and Energy Commitments
Operating since 2019 on a repurposed former coal-plant site, the Jackson County facility delivers essential compute capacity for digital workloads. Under the new expansion plan, Google is funding 100% of its own power and infrastructure costs to ensure local utility rate-payers do not bear the financial burden of site growth.
To address local grid demand, Google established a $2 million Energy Impact Fund in partnership with the Tennessee Valley Authority (TVA) and CAANEAL. This fund will directly support energy efficiency and weatherization initiatives for local residents.
Community Investments and Local Impact
According to Google, the expansion initiative builds upon multi-year economic and community projects in the region. Key stats and commitments tied to the Jackson County expansion include:
- $1.5 billion investment deployed across calendar years 2026 and 2027.
- 100% self-funded energy and infrastructure expansion costs.
- $2 million committed to energy efficiency programs via TVA and CAANEAL.
- $550,000 donation for STEM education kits targeting fourth-to-eighth graders.
- 130,000+ Alabamians trained in digital skills through previous corporate programs.
However, one ongoing caveat with massive data center expansions remains resource intensity. Even with self-funded energy infrastructure and environmental support for local sites like the Paint Rock River Watershed, large campus operations continue to demand substantial local power grid capacity and natural resources over time.
